runtime-host: intermittent 'stopped responding during startup' after a Windows upgrade over an existing profile

Description

On the Windows upgrade-lifecycle check, the app installed by an upgrade intermittently fails to start: its own stderr reports

```
[runtime-host] fatal: Error: Runtime Host stopped responding during startup
at runtimeHostStartupError (…/app.asar/node_modules/@maka/runtime-host/dist/client/startup-error.js:25:20)
at RuntimeHostDesktopManagerImpl.connect (…/dist/main/runtime-host-desktop-manager.js:317:19)
at async RuntimeHostReconnectLifecycleImpl.start (…/reconnect-lifecycle.js:62:45)
```

and the renderer never mounts, so the packaged smoke times out.

**Observed:** [run 32324991998](https://github.com/apache/maka/actions/runs/32324991998/job/96295423079) on #3241, step `Exercise pinned-version upgrade and uninstall`. The sequence that failed: the pinned 0.1.9 baseline installed and verified clean → upgraded to the current 0.1.11 build → the upgraded app's Runtime Host stopped responding during startup. The standalone smoke of the same 0.1.11 build passed minutes earlier in the same job, so the build starts fine against a fresh profile.

**What makes the upgrade path different:** the lifecycle deliberately reuses one isolated HOME and user-data directory across both versions — that is the point of an upgrade test — so the 0.1.11 Runtime Host starts against whatever state 0.1.9's run left under that HOME (host socket/lock/config). Whether the hang is caused by that leftover state or is an unlucky cold-runner slowdown is exactly what the log cannot yet say: the fatal is a client-side startup timeout, and the Host process's own stderr is not captured in the verifier output.

**Attribution note:** this surfaced through #3241's new CDP diagnostics (the app wrote `DevToolsActivePort`, the poll named the bound port, and the endpoint never answered — which is what pointed at the main process rather than the port plumbing). Some of the historical `did not expose CDP within 30 seconds` failures in this step may share this cause, but that cannot be established retroactively from the old logs.

**Suggested next steps:**
1. Capture the Runtime Host child's stderr (or its log file) into the lifecycle verifier's failure output, so a startup hang is attributable to the Host's own last words rather than the client's timeout.
2. Reproduce locally: install 0.1.9's profile state, then start a current build against it, in a loop.
3. If leftover state is the trigger, the fix likely belongs in Host startup's handling of a predecessor's socket/lock remnants.

Not caused by #3241 (verifier-only changes); filed separately so the product-side question is trackable.
